ROCK ‘N’ ROLL ON TV SUCKS»

Saturday 12 PM, RDS Dublin
There is relatively little music programming on Irish television, with only The Last Broadcast and UK shows such as Later With Jools Holland being screened with any regularity. However, when music shows are commissioned, they are frequently pulled from the schedules for failing to attract sufficiently high viewing figures.
